Participatory action

Time: 09:00-14:00
Location: Socioinformatics information stand, Building 42, Foyer, Stand 7

What to expect: A core element of generative language models will be illustrated with a game machine and attention will be drawn to human-machine interactions. Climb into the engine room of a large language model and decide for the computer which words should be used to tell the story. Can you get the language model to write your story?

Laboratory tour

Time: 09:00-15:00
There is no fixed start time for this offer, you can simply drop in at any time during the specified period.
Location: Building 48, Room 260

What you can expect: The Chair of Robotic Systems is opening its research lab. Various outdoor vehicles, such as an autonomous minibus, a self-driving tractor and other research robots will be on display. A special highlight is the android robot, which interacts verbally and non-verbally with visitors.
